Featured Artist: Stuart Haygarth of London

Published November 14th, 2007

Stuart Haygarth is a  photographic illustrator whose work involves the building of collages/ assemblages using both 3D objects and 2D imagery. The collage is then photographed with a large format camera and studio lighting so that the work can be produced in print form.
The work has attracted a wide variety of assignments from advertising, design, publishing and editorial fields. He has also created several permanent installation pieces.
